Galaxy Z Flip 4 and Galaxy Z Fold 4, the two newest members of Samsung’s foldable product family, took their place in the markets a few months ago. Among these two devices, which were offered to users with Android 12, only a version called Android 12L was designed for Galaxy Z Fold 4. Now it has been crowned with the One UI 5.0 update, both of which are based on Android 13.

What does the Android 13 and One UI 5.0 update offer?

A few weeks ago, the South Korean-based technology company started to spread the stable version of the new One UI software, which uses the infrastructure of Android 13, to the whole world. This version first met the Galaxy S22 series.

The stable One UI 5.0 update, which was announced to be released for Galaxy Z Flip 4 and Galaxy Z Fold 4, has been released for users living in South Korea. The beta version of this version has been activated for US residents. Its stable version will be activated soon in this country and later in Europe.

One UI 5.0 software allows users to decide the fate of notifications from applications. Because any application that cannot get users’ permission can disturb anyone.

Saying goodbye to annoying and unwanted notifications from application screens that are opened without asking the user’s permission, Android 13 has the RegiStar infrastructure of the Samsung Goodlock application. Thanks to this infrastructure, your foldable screen becomes pressure sensitive and can detect movements related to it.
